Prior Art Conventionally, one feeding gutter was commonly arranged in front of a large number of chicken cages arranged in a row, and a feeding pipe was reciprocated on the gutter along the entire length of the gutter. There is one that is installed so that bait is automatically fed into the gutter from the pipe. In this automatic feeding device, in which a feeding pipe is moved while constantly dropping a fixed amount of feed from the feeding pipe, chickens with a low appetite tend to have a large amount of uneaten food due to individual differences among chickens. Gradually, an excessive amount of food may be deposited in only one area, and the food may be wasted. Therefore, in the past, it was necessary to manually smooth out the accumulated bait to make the amount of bait in the feeding trough uniform.

Purpose of the invention In view of the above, the present invention automatically stops feeding in areas where there is a lot of leftover food in the feeding gutter, and automatically starts feeding in areas where there is little leftover food so that the feeder is constantly fed. It is an object of the present invention to propose a livestock feeding device that can keep the amount of feed in a gutter constant.

1 is a feeding hopper, the lower part of which communicates with the screw chamber 2. Reference numeral 3 denotes a screw conveyor, which is driven by a motor 4 and is adapted to supply bait into a drop shooter 5, and these constitute bait supply means. The drop shooter 5 has a bendable connecting tube 5a in the middle thereof.
The lower drop shooter 5b can swing freely. Reference numeral 6 denotes a feeding amount detection switch installed in the middle of the drop shooter 5, using a capacitance type switch or a photoelectric switch. is sensed and the motor 4 is stopped. Reference numeral 7 denotes a protective member made of a rubber material or the like to protect the switch 6. The lower end 5c of the lower drop shooter 5b is arranged to face the feeding gutter 8, and is set at a height far away from the upper surface of the food deposited in the feeding gutter 8. Reference numeral 9 denotes a cylindrical leveler, which is fitted into the lower part of the drop shooter 5b so as to be able to rise and fall freely.The amount of feed is determined by the gap D between the lower end feeding port 9a of the leveler 9 and the inner bottom surface of the feeding gutter 8. Ru. Reference numeral 10 denotes a guide member formed in an annular shape that fits into the feeding gutter 8, and an arm 11.
It is fixed to the leveler 9 so as to be vertically adjustable. If the guide member 10 is formed into an annular shape as shown in the figure, it will also come into contact with the inner surface of the gutter and guide the leveler 9 along the gutter even if the gutter is bent vertically and laterally. However, when the leveler 9 is made to follow only the upper and lower bends of the gutter, it may be formed into a leg shape that contacts only the bottom surface of the gutter 8. Each of the above-mentioned constituent members is provided so that the leveler 9 reciprocates along the entire length of the gutter 8 by means of a trolley provided on the upper part of the cage, and this reciprocating drive means is well known.

Now, when the motor 4 is driven and the feed in the hopper 1 is fed into the drop shooters 5 and 5b by the screw conveyor 3, and the feed is fed to the feed amount detection switch 6, the switch 6 is turned off. Then, the motor 4 stops and feed supply is stopped.

In this state, when the drop shooters 5, 5b, leveler 9, etc. are moved in the longitudinal direction of the gutter 8 (arrow A-B direction), the bait in the drop shooter 5b flows out into the gutter 8 through the gap D, and the amount of the outflow is D makes it a constant amount. When the bait flows out, the upper surface of the bait in the drop shooter 5b is lowered, and the switch 6 is turned on to drive the motor 4 and replenish the bait by the amount that flows out. This gap D can be adjusted by vertically adjusting the leveler 9 with respect to the guide member 10. Also,
When the gutter 8 is bent in the vertical direction, the guide member 10 moves up and down along the bend, and the leveler 9
is moved vertically in the same way, so the gap D is always constant even if the gutter is bent in the vertical direction. Furthermore, when the guide member 10 is formed in an annular shape as shown in the figure, the guide member 10 also comes into contact with the inner surface of the gutter 8,
Even if the gutter 8 meanders in the longitudinal direction, the leveler 9 is guided along the gutter so that the leveler 9 does not come off from the gutter 8. Next, if there is an excessive amount of uneaten bait 12 in the middle of the gutter as shown in the figure, when the leveler 9 passes over the bait section 12, the leveler 9
The upper part of the bait 12 is leveled by the lower end 9a, and at the same time, the bait part 12 blocks the bait from flowing out from within the leveler 9, so the drop shooter 5b
The upper surface of the food inside is raised by the food being replenished;
By turning off the switch 6, the motor 4 is stopped, and feeding of food is stopped. When the bait passes through the bait portion 12, the same feeding operation as described above is performed.

Effects of the invention As described above, according to the invention, the feed amount detection switch 6 detects the height of the accumulation in the drop shooter and automatically replenishes the feed. Compared to a system that controls the supply of food using a conventional method, more accurate detection can be performed at all times. In other words, since the food in the gutter is scattered back and forth by the chickens, the shape of the food piled up is disturbed, making it inconsistent and causing erroneous detection. In this case, the upper end surface of the deposited food always remains flat without being affected by the chickens, allowing for accurate detection. In addition, if the movable operating end of the detection switch 6 protrudes into the gutter, the operating end may be moved with its beak when the chickens are eating or when not eating, which may lead to malfunction. Since it is installed at a predetermined height of the drop shooter, even if a switch with a similar movable operating end is used, there is no possibility of malfunction caused by the chickens, making it extremely effective in practice as a feeding device.
